A balloon is filled with hydrogen at room temperature. It will burst if pressure exceeds 0.2bar. If at 1bar pressure the gas occupies 2.27 L volume, upto what volume can the ballon be expanded? |
Answer» <html><body><p></p><a href="https://interviewquestions.tuteehub.com/tag/solution-25781" style="font-weight:bold;" target="_blank" title="Click to know more about SOLUTION">SOLUTION</a> :According to Boyle.s <a href="https://interviewquestions.tuteehub.com/tag/law-184" style="font-weight:bold;" target="_blank" title="Click to know more about LAW">LAW</a> `p_1V_1 = p_2 V_2` <br/> If `p_1` is 1 <a href="https://interviewquestions.tuteehub.com/tag/bar-892478" style="font-weight:bold;" target="_blank" title="Click to know more about BAR">BAR</a>, `V_1` is 2.27L <br/> If `p_2` = 0.2 bar, then `V_2 = p_1V_1/p_2 = V_2 = <a href="https://interviewquestions.tuteehub.com/tag/1bar-282929" style="font-weight:bold;" target="_blank" title="Click to know more about 1BAR">1BAR</a> xx 2.27L/0.2bar = 11.35 L`<br/> <a href="https://interviewquestions.tuteehub.com/tag/since-644476" style="font-weight:bold;" target="_blank" title="Click to know more about SINCE">SINCE</a> balloon bursts at 0.2 bar pressure, the volume of balloon should be lass than 11.35L</body></html> | |
